Output 7856c93256ea732638b080c2a016d65adf75da6d57a916ba565479c0feb69628:14

value
587900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d638bce4bd0085ec64ff1a29b2411ca1e51fe32e OP_EQUALVERIFY OP_CHECKSIG
address
1LXhaGXYZXoV8PxaQEnnN8iQ4JiatvcFn6
transaction
7856c93256ea732638b080c2a016d65adf75da6d57a916ba565479c0feb69628
spent
true